## Deploying the Gatewick Proctor Queue

Deploys are pretty painless: push to main, wait for the pipeline, then watch the queue drain dashboard for five minutes. If candidates pile up mid-exam, roll back first and ask questions later — the queue replays safely. Everything the workers care about lives in one config block, shown here for reference.

settings of bafof-yagef:
JOROX_PIN=8740
JOROX_TENANT=pelox
JOROX_METRICS_HOST=metrics.jorox.qorvelworks.internal
JOROX_SEAL=seal_c78f63c1
JOROX_STANDBY_TEAM=norax

- [ ] **Verify hermetic build attestation.** As part of the Corvell key ceremony, confirm your plugin builds cleanly under the new Slatemoor hermetic build system with no network fetches. Run the sealed build twice and compare digests; they must match exactly before the signing key is issued. To enroll your plugin in the attestation registry, enter the recovery passphrase provided below.

vault phrase of tajeg-tageg = pelix-druix-holius-briael-zorwyn-frawyn-fraox-norok-drueth-aldiel

MEMO — For the Board

Quick read on the regional sales review: the Westvale territory beat plan again, while Norhaven slipped for a third straight quarter. Tomas Greel is reshuffling account coverage and wants one more cycle before we call it. Full figures at the next session. Our related planning note follows directly below.

board note of kageg-bahof: The renewal with Holwynax Holdings closes at $2 million a year, 5 percent below the last contract. Project Ulaath slips by two quarters because of the supplier delay.

The Orvane Labs bike cage and the east and west parking gates operate on separate access schedules, and facilities desk staff should note that visitor vehicles may only use the west gate between 07:00 and 19:00. Cyclists requesting cage access must show a valid day pass, and their details should be entered in the access ledger before the cage is opened. Gates must never be propped open, even briefly, during deliveries. When a manual override is required at either gate, use the code below.

staff pass of fadup-fawig = bdg-FUNKS-4